You take the average of the test scores including the final and make it greater than or equal to 80. The final counts as two tests. Let's say the final exam score is "x".

[tex] \frac{73+82+83+2x}{5} \geq 80[/tex]

Then you solve for x the final exam grade to get a B in the class.
start by multiplying the 5 over to the other side and adding the exam grades.

238 + 2x ≥ 400

subtract 238 from both sides

2x ≥ 162

divide by 2

x ≥ 81

since the final counts as 2 tests they need to score at least an 81 to get an 80 average for the course.
